Hippie last names can vary widely, with many individuals choosing nature-inspired surnames or names related to peace and love. Some common examples include Sunflower, Meadow, Rainbow, and Harmony.

Are Hippie Last Names Legally Recognized?

In most places, you can legally change your last name to a hippie-inspired name as long as it follows standard naming laws. It’s advisable to check the regulations in your area before making the change.
